Transaction fd59f71fa723c7494996dff235a1b85ed3dd193bd81937139e4afc500bce414b
1 Input
1 Output
-
fd59f71fa723c7494996dff235a1b85ed3dd193bd81937139e4afc500bce414b:0
- value
- 1390233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4f88240dffaa8cb8eea7e4cbbf7e41727c1864 OP_EQUAL
- address
- 3EaCUZL22zVv378iSu8nXfJqMbgUw285TV